CONTINUOUSLY VARIABLE TRANSAXLE SYSTEM(for 1ZR-FAE) HYDRAULIC TEST

  1. PERFORM HYDRAULIC TEST

    1. Measure the secondary oil pressure.

      CAUTION:

      A secondary oil pressure test should always be carried out with at least 2 people. One person should observe the condition of the wheels and wheel chocks while the other is performing the test.

      Note:
      • This test must be performed after checking and confirming that the engine is normal.

      • Perform this test with the CVT fluid temperature between 50 and 100°C (122 and 212°F).

      • Perform this test with the air conditioning off.

      • Do not perform the stall speed test for more than 5 seconds.

      • When performing the stall speed test repeatedly, wait for 15 seconds or more between tests.

      1. Fully apply the parking brake and chock all 4 wheels.

      2. Connect the GTS to the DLC3.

      3. Start the engine.

      4. Turn the GTS on.

      5.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/ Active Test / Connect the TC and TE1.

        Tip:

        Observe the value of A/T Oil Pressure in the Data List while performing the Active Test.

      6. Keep your left foot firmly on the brake pedal and move the shift lever to D.

      7. Depress the accelerator pedal as much as possible with your right foot. Quickly read the highest secondary oil pressure reading when the engine speed reaches stall speed and release the accelerator pedal immediately.

      8. Keep your left foot firmly on the brake pedal and move the shift lever to R.

      9. Depress the accelerator pedal as much as possible with your right foot. Quickly read the highest secondary oil pressure reading when the engine speed reaches stall speed and release the accelerator pedal immediately.

        Specified Secondary Oil Pressure

        Stall Speed

        Shift Lever Position

        Secondary Oil Pressure

        2150 +/- 300 rpm

        D

        2.8 to 4.8 MPa

        (28.5 to 49.0 kgf/cm2, 406 to 697 psi)

        R

        2.9 to 4.8 MPa

        (29.5 to 49.0 kgf/cm2, 420 to 697 psi)

        Tip:

        If the secondary oil pressure exceeds the maximum value or drops below the minimum value, a solenoid valve, regulator valve or modulator valve may be malfunctioning.
